Effective Link Building Strategies

Building links pointing back to your website can be a very time consuming task and sometimes you might not know where to start. Let’s take a look at some effective link building strategies.

1. Contact other website owners and offer a link exchange. It is a good idea to contact website owners with sites in the same niche as yours. You can create a ‘recommended sites’ page or list on your site where you can place links to other sites that agree to a link exchange.

2. Create a ‘link to us’ section on your website. This is to make an offer to your website visitors to link back to your website. Give them all the information that they will need to link to your site such as URL and anchor text. Have a section where they can leave their details for you to link to their site.

3. Make sure that your website contains good quality information so that other website owners will want to link to your site. Website owners don’t want to be linking to a site that is not of good quality so the quality of your website is always important for link building.

4. Search the internet for other websites that may mention your website or your website content but do not include a link to your site. Contact those website owners and ask them to include a link to your website.

5. Post comments on blogs and include a link back to your website. Always make appropriate comments that are related to the post topic or your comment will not likely be approved it is looks like spam.

6. Use internal link building from within your own site. For example, when you create a new page or post on your website you can include a link to your main home page or any other page on your site.

7. Article marketing is a very effective way to build backlinks. Write some good quality articles and submit them to article directories and include a link to your site in the resource box.

8. Offer to do a guest post on someone’s blog. When you write a guest post for someone else’s blog they get the benefit of new content for their blog and you get the benefit of being able to include a link back to your site.

9. Look at your competitors backlinks and see if you can get some of those same sites to link to your website.

10. Use social networking sites like Squidoo and Hubpages to build backlinks to your site. It is quick and easy to create a Squidoo lens or Hubpage and include a backlink within the content.

These are ten great link building strategies and you can use all of them or some of them. The important thing is to use some methods and put in the effort that is required for effective link building.

Promotional products can increase your company’s success

Promotional products, items that are typically imprinted with a company’s logo, can play an important role in a companies’ success by increasing brand recognition and making customers feel appreciated.

Reeling in customers

The obvious benefit of a promotional product is that consumers using the product will become increasingly familiar with the brand. This will make the company more recognizable and memorable to consumers.

Popular promotional products, like a t-shirt with the company name on it, may become a man’s casual shirt that he wears to play basketball with his friends. Every time he wears that shirt, his friends see the logo and will recognize it later when they are looking to fulfill a need in that business.

The friend will not recall where he saw the logo, but familiarity with having seen it before will give that company an edge. Or, think of promotional pens. Each time a consumer pulls it out of her bag to jot a note, she is engraving that logo into her memory a little bit further.

Showing customers you appreciate them
While promotional products help increase your companies’ brand recognition, and opens doors to new customers, your current customers are a critical part of the promotional product process.

When the competition gets fierce, your customers are more likely to stay with you because you have treated them so well. That could lead to referrals.

Also, remember that if you have a special group of customers that gives you far more business than your average customer, you should consider giving them a better product than the other customers, especially if those customers are aware they are especially generous customers.

What are the best products today?

You are generally better off choosing products that will be used frequently rather than shoved in the back corner of an office, or thrown away after only one use. The greater likelihood the product will be used often, the more opportunities to increase brand recognition.

Though there are some obvious promotional products, like pens and t-shirts, carefully consider your clients and the nature of your business when making a selection.

For example, Google gave web customers a wireless computer mouse in one of their promotional packages. This would not be appropriate for a gardener, but is highly useful and highly likely to be reused frequently by a web client.

Also, make sure you choose a product that does not fall apart easily, or a pen that is prone to leak. You want your customers to be able to say to their friends, “Oh this cool pocketknife?

The company that does such-and-such gave it to me.”

Wearable items make up over a quarter of the promotional products industry, followed by writing instruments like pens, but there is no black and white “wrong” and “right” promotional product.

Make your decisions wisely, and boost your companies’ image with your existing and potential customers.


SEO Article Marketing Tips

Using seo article marketing methods can do a lot to drive very targeted traffic to your website all for free. If you know how to do it right, you can really get a lot of benefit out of all the articles you write.

many people seem to think that you can either write for humans or you can write for the search engines. They don’t seem to understand that you can actually do it both ways with one article.

To get the most out of all your seo article marketing efforts the first thing you have to do is find a good list of quality keywords associated with your niche website (fairly high searches with little competition).

Once you have your keyword list all you have to do is write quality articles around that keyword. As long as the articles you write are quality and provide good information that’s going to be half the battle.

Do not get stuck in the idea that you have to include your keyword in every sentence of your article. That is considered keyword stuffing and won’t do you any good.

Strive for no more than 3% keyword density. Put the keyword in your title, the first and last paragraph and a few other times throughout your article. That’s all you need.

The simplicity, yet effectiveness, of this methods is why it is so popular. By writing articles you will set yourself up as an expert in your niche. you can use your articles to provide a lot of helpful information to all you readers.

Online, it’s always best to give something of value before you expect to get anything. By giving your readers some good and helpful information and advice, you are building trust with them.

The other huge benefit of doing this, with the proper keywords, is that the search engines will reward you for your content with a high search engine ranking. This will give you a lot of organic traffic.

For example, if your niche is bird houses all you need to do is write some keyword optimized articles around the keyword “bird houses”. Then when someone does a search and types in the phrase “bird houses” your article may well be one of the first that shows up on the page! How is that for free traffic!

The same basic principle holds true for making blog posts. When you are adding content to your blog you simply follow these same basic steps. That way when someone does a search for your keywords they will see your blog post and subsequently land on your blog.

This provides you with a great opportunity to add an autoresponder to your blog and capture the visitors email address so you can contact them again.

Using this seo article marketing method can really help you ramp up your website traffic and the best part? It’s all for free! Just be careful to not fall into the mind set that if one keyword in an article is good, ten must be better. Don’t try to stuff your article with keywords, a few well placed keywords is all you need.
